
ALABAMA — A woman was arrested after police say she injured a man with a knife during a domestic dispute over the weekend.
According to the Huntsville Police Department, officers responded around 5:30 p.m. Saturday to the 1900 block of Sparkman Drive for a report of a possible cutting. They found a man with injuries consistent with being struck with a knife. His injuries were described as non-life-threatening.
Investigators said the victim was in a relationship with the suspect and the altercation occurred inside a residence, where the man was struck with a knife.
Police identified the suspect as 46-year-old Shelonda Marie Walton of Huntsville. She was arrested and charged with second-degree domestic violence with a knife.
Walton is being held in the Madison County Jail on a $13,000 bond.
